Steven Erikson Quotes
Gifts Are Rarely Appreciated,' Arathan Said, And In His Mind He Was Remembering His First Night With Feren. 'And The One Who Receives Knows Only Confusion. At First. And Then Hunger... For More. And In That Hunger, There Is Expectation, And So The Gift Ceases Being A Gift, And Becomes Payment, And To Give Itself Becomes A Privilege And To Receive It A Right. By This All Sentiment Sours.
